From 862797e51afce797af5295d44af5e74147558735 Mon Sep 17 00:00:00 2001 From: "Kevin Veen-Birkenbach [aka. Frantz]" Date: Thu, 19 Aug 2021 13:46:35 +0200 Subject: [PATCH] Moved variables for better readability --- docker-volume-backup.sh |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/docker-volume-backup.sh b/docker-volume-backup.sh index 6d012b7..025052f 100644 --- a/docker-volume-backup.sh +++ b/docker-volume-backup.sh @@ -5,6 +5,9 @@ # backup_time="$(date '+%Y%m%d%H%M%S')"; backups_folder="/Backups/"; +repository_name="$(cd "$(dirname "$(readlink -f "${0}")")" && basename `git rev-parse --show-toplevel`)"; +machine_id="$(sha256sum /etc/machine-id | head -c 64)"; +backup_repository_folder="$backups_folder$machine_id/$repository_name/"; for volume_name in $(docker volume ls --format '{{.Name}}'); do for container_name in $(docker ps -a --filter volume=$volume_name --format '{{.Names}}'); @@ -12,9 +15,6 @@ do echo "stop container: $container_name" && docker stop "$container_name" for source_path in $(docker inspect --format '{{ range .Mounts }}{{ if eq .Type "volume" }}{{ println .Destination }}{{ end }}{{ end }}' "$container_name"); do - repository_name="$(cd "$(dirname "$(readlink -f "${0}")")" && basename `git rev-parse --show-toplevel`)"; - machine_id="$(sha256sum /etc/machine-id | head -c 64)"; - backup_repository_folder="$backups_folder$machine_id/$repository_name/"; destination_path="$backup_repository_folder""latest/$container_name$source_path"; log_path="$backup_repository_folder""log.txt"; backup_dir_path="$backup_repository_folder""diffs/$backup_time/$container_name$source_path";